开发者社区> 问答> 正文

MySQL Update查询中“字段列表”中的未知列错误

尝试执行此更新查询时,我不断收到MySQL错误#1054:

UPDATE MASTER_USER_PROFILE, TRAN_USER_BRANCH SET MASTER_USER_PROFILE.fellow=y WHERE MASTER_USER_PROFILE.USER_ID = TRAN_USER_BRANCH.USER_ID AND TRAN_USER_BRANCH.BRANCH_ID = 17 这可能是一些语法错误,但我尝试使用内部联接和其他更改,但始终收到相同的消息:

Unknown column 'y' in 'field list'

展开
收起
保持可爱mmm 2020-05-11 11:26:42 530 0
1 条回答
写回答
取消 提交回答
  • 用单引号将要传递给mysql服务器的所有字符串括起来;例如:

    $name = "my name" $query = " INSERT INTO mytable VALUES ( 1 , '$name') " 请注意,尽管查询是用双引号引起来的,但您必须将任何字符串都用单引号引起来。来源:stack overflow

    2020-05-11 11:26:54
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
搭建电商项目架构连接MySQL 立即下载
搭建4层电商项目架构,实战连接MySQL 立即下载
PolarDB MySQL引擎重磅功能及产品能力盛大发布 立即下载

相关镜像